Magic Leap is a pioneer in Augmented Reality (AR) optics, display systems, platforms, devices services, prototyping and manufacturing capabilities. We are known for our unmatched optics stack and have developed ultra-lightweight waveguides and display systems that advance what is possible in AR. With more than a decade of experience in AR innovation, we have made groundbreaking advancements in text legibility, color fidelity and rich digital content visuals while continually expanding the field of view to create engaging, immersive AR experiences.

The opportunity 

As a Staff Hardware Engineer within our Display and Perception hardware team, you will develop and integrate cutting-edge display and camera systems, pushing the boundaries of image quality, power efficiency, and form factor innovation. 

What you’ll do 

  • Lead hardware and systems decisions through all phases of research & development, engineering design cycles, and validation through productization.
  • Work with interdisciplinary teams and limited supervision, developing complex high-speed low-power small form factor hardware designs including: camera, display and illumination hardware module development, and supporting driver electronics.
  • Rapid prototyping, simulation, development, and testing of hardware proof of concepts, products, and experiments.
  • Define and execute test plans for design verification, experiments, and compliance testing.
  • Provide technical leadership in vendor discussions while fostering strong vendor partnerships.
  • Communicate complex system trade-offs and provide recommendations to enable product decisions.

The experience you bring

  • 8+ years of professional experience in hardware product development
  • Bach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ering, or equivalent relevant experience in an applicable field. 
  • Solid foundation of electrical engineering principles with expertise in analog and digital design.
  • Experience designing hardware, firmware, and software that  interfaces across multiple modules in a system.
  • Experience designing and validating display modules, camera sensors, and compute (SoCs, GPUs, ASICs) systems.
  • Experience in high-speed and mixed-signal schematic capture and PCB design using Cadence OrCAD and other CAD tools.
  • Experience using electrical bench equipment (power supplies, oscilloscopes, network analyzers, logic analyzers, & function generators)
  • Skilled in managing vendors and driving collaboration with CM and JDM partners to achieve development goals.
  • Technical communication skills (verbal and written). Experience interfacing with cross-functional teams and driving data-driven decisions. 

It’s exciting if you also have

  • Experience launching high-volume products into the market.
  • Coding skills in C, C++, Python, etc.
  • Display system architecture and module design experience
  • Camera system architecture and module design experience
  • Experience with high-speed interfaces such as MIPI D-PHY/C-PHY, MIPI CSI-2, MIPI DSI-2, DisplayPort, USB, and PCIe.
  • Experience with uLED/LED, LCOS, and LCD technologies and manufacturing processes.
  • Experience using optical metrology and test equipment (optical power meters, spectrometers, photodetectors, & integration spheres)
